Abstract:

 

The purpose of this research is to describe student productive thinking in solving problem in algebra. The subject of this research is choosing four subjects which have different productive thinking. The first instrument is using self-regulated learning questionnaire, then the second instrument is giving a test and interviews. The result indicated that student with high self-regulated learning, thinks really critically, and his creativity has the ability of thinking productive. Students which have the ability to think productively have the following characteristics: they are able to identify problem well, they are able to write facts clearly and they are able to describe what is already known and what has been questioned in the question precisely, right in writing the mathematics model, and they are also able to make calculation and check the rightness which happen as well. They give more than one relevant idea and find more various ways dealing with the problems, give the answer in detail, clear and complex, make right conclusion and doing calculation precisely, double check their answers by using the known matter in the problem.
